Will my insurance cover the fees?

I am an out-of-network (OON) provider and do not bill insurance companies directly. However, many PPO insurance plans offer partial reimbursement for out-of-network mental health services.

If you would like to seek reimbursement from your insurance provider, I can provide a monthly superbill (a detailed clinical receipt) that you can submit to your insurance company.

I recommend calling the number on the back of your insurance card before our first session and asking:

  1. Do I have out-of-network mental health benefits for outpatient psychotherapy?
  2. What is my out-of-network deductible, and has it been met?
  3. What percentage of the session fee is covered after my deductible is met?
  4. How do I submit superbills for reimbursement?
